Australia And New Zealand Banking Group E-3 visa sponsorship data

YesAustralia And New Zealand Banking Group has sponsored Australians on the E-3 visa, filing 105 US Department of Labor Labor Condition Applications across all available fiscal years, with 95.2% certified. The median annualized wage offered is $209,945. Most filings are for Financial Managers, with positions mostly based in NY.

Roles Australia And New Zealand Banking Group sponsors

11 distinct roles have been filed for E-3 visas by Australia And New Zealand Banking Group. Click a role to see all employers sponsoring it.

11 roles
Role Filings Cert rate Median wage Top state
Financial Managers 41 97.6% $245,805 NY
Financial and Investment Analysts 41 92.7% $180,000 NY
Credit Analysts 13 100.0% $190,000 NY
Managers, All Other 3 100.0% $173,600 NY
Chief Executives 1 0.0% $335,300 NY
Financial Examiners 1 100.0% $226,000 NY
Financial Risk Specialists 1 100.0% $300,000 NY
Personal Financial Advisors 1 100.0% $148,793 NY
Project Management Specialists 1 100.0% $222,390 NY
Risk Management Specialists 1 100.0% $80,000 NY
Securities, Commodities, and Financial Services Sales Agents 1 100.0% $245,000 NY

Filings by fiscal year

Year-over-year trend for Australia And New Zealand Banking Group's E-3 visa filings. DOL's fiscal year runs October–September.

FY Filings Cert rate Trend
FY2020 23 91.3%
FY2021 11 90.9%
FY2022 19 94.7%
FY2023 12 100.0%
FY2024 14 100.0%
FY2025 20 95.0%
FY2026 6 100.0%
